Python库Frida 9.0.8详细安装指南

版权申诉
0 下载量 192 浏览量 更新于2024-11-29 收藏 21.97MB ZIP 举报
资源摘要信息:"Python库 | frida-9.0.8-py2.7-macosx-10.11-intel.egg" 本资源是一套Python库,具体的名称为"frida-9.0.8-py2.7-macosx-10.11-intel.egg"。该资源适用于使用Python开发语言的开发者,并且是针对macOS 10.11系统环境下针对Intel架构的计算机。在Python编程语言的生态系统中,扩展包(Egg文件)是一种用于分发Python软件包的格式,类似于Windows系统中的.exe文件或Linux系统中的.deb或.rpm文件。Egg文件是一种归档格式,旨在简化安装过程,并使得Python模块及其资源可以被打包成一个单独的文件。 资源的全名为"frida-9.0.8-py2.7-macosx-10.11-intel.egg",这表明它是为Python版本2.7所准备的,对应于Frida工具的特定版本。Frida是一个动态代码插桩工具,广泛应用于逆向工程、安全审计和恶意软件分析等领域。它能够让你以脚本的形式注入到应用程序中,从而实现在运行时修改程序的行为,进行API调用跟踪、函数挂钩等操作。 使用本资源的前提是需要解压,因为"egg"格式本质上是一个压缩文件。解压后,开发者可以进一步安装并使用Frida库。关于具体的安装方法,资源描述中提供了一个CSDN博客文章的链接,其中详细介绍了如何进行安装和配置。安装Frida库可以通过Python包管理器pip进行,对于特定的Egg文件,可能会涉及直接将其放置到Python的site-packages目录下或其他特定的路径中。 在技术术语中,"蛋包"(Egg)文件由PEP 323和PEP 390定义,而PEP指的是Python改进提案(Python Enhancement Proposals),是记录Python社区中对语言改进的提案标准。Egg文件的创建和使用在Python 2中比较常见,而在Python 3中,人们更倾向于使用wheel格式,这是Python 3.3之后引入的另一种打包格式,旨在取代egg。 对于Python库的标签"python 开发语言 Python库",表明该资源是与Python编程语言紧密相关的开发工具包,专门提供给Python开发者使用。标签还强调了库的范畴,这意味着它不是一个独立的软件,而是一套可以集成到其他Python项目中的功能模块。 在列表中,只提供了一个文件名称"frida-9.0.8-py2.7-macosx-10.11-intel.egg",说明这是一个独立的资源包,其他依赖项或者必要的文件并没有在本描述中提及。然而,在实际操作中,可能还需要安装一些基础的Python开发工具和依赖库,以确保Frida能够正常工作。 综上所述,本资源是一个专门用于Python开发的Frida库压缩包,适用于macOS 10.11操作系统以及Intel架构的计算机,并且需要Python版本2.7。开发者在使用该资源前需要进行解压,并遵循官方提供的指导方法进行安装。资源通过Egg格式进行分发,这是一种较早时期的Python包格式,现在已被更现代的格式所替代,但它仍然适用于特定的环境和版本。